2015 SESSION
SB 967 Extended Foster Care Services and Support Program; created.
Introduced by: Barbara A. Favola |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Extended foster care services and support. Creates the Extended Foster Care Services and Support Program to provide foster care services and support, including foster care maintenance payments, to qualifying individuals age 18 to 21 years who were formerly in the custody of a local board of social services.
